State of GA Proportional Blame Doctrine


Local statutes follows a modified comparative negligence rule, meaning you can still recover compensation as long as you are under half at fault. However, your settlement is lowered by your degree of fault.

A experienced Fulton County attorney will defend to eliminate any blame placed on you, ensuring you receive the highest personal injury compensation possible under Georgia law.

How long do I have to file a claim with a personal injury attorney Atlanta?


Under state legal guidelines, you generally have 24 months from the date of your injury to file a formal negligence claim or personal injury lawsuit. This deadline applies whether your case involves a bike crash and failing to act in time could result in a permanent loss of rights.
